Quality driven organizations recognize that preventing material mix-ups begins with reliable verification. Modern manufacturing environments depend on processes that can distinguish unknown alloys from known specifications with confidence – relying solely on labeling is insufficient. Consequently, Positive Material Identification (PMI) is essential for preventing mix-ups and safeguarding product quality.
In this live webinar, you’ll learn exactly when to use Grade Identification / Grade Search for unknown materials, and when to rely on Grade Control / Grade Verification to confirm an expected grade quickly and confidently.
If you know what the grade should be, verification gives you the fastest, clearest answer: OK or No Match. If you don’t, identification helps you narrow down possible candidates from your grade libraries.
